Tickets
Each candidate will receive 2 guest tickets to the Conferring Ceremony (candidates do not require a ticket). Unfortunately, there will be no extra tickets available due to large numbers being conferred.

The Conferring Ceremony will take place in the Examination Hall in the Royal College of Surgeons in Ireland, St Stephens Green at 15.00 on Thursday 15th November. Doors will open 1hour prior to the ceremony; guests must produce their tickets at the entrance to the Examination Hall. Guests will not be permitted to enter without a ticket.
Children under the age of 12 are not permitted into the Conferring Hall.

Hire of Academic Dress
Correct academic dress must be worn at graduation. Gowns must be ordered online through Phelan Conan Ltd by using the pre-booking facility at www.phelanconan.com
Please select ‘Student Hire' and ‘RCSI' and follow the instructions. The reference number should be taken with you once collecting your gown.

You must pre-book your gown with Phelan Conan before Sunday 11th November 2012. Please note that no orders will be accepted on the day of the Conferring.
It is essential that you select the correct faculty and award otherwise you are in danger of being conferred in the incorrect robe.

The cost of hiring a gown is €45.00 and a booking deposit of €155.00 is required to pre pay for your gown, this deposit will be refunded back onto your credit card once your gown has been returned to Phelan Conan.
The online booking facility will be available from Monday 10th September 2012.

Robes must be returned to Phelan Conan immediately following the conferring ceremony in the Atrium, RCSI. Failure to do so will result in the loss of your deposit.

All queries relation to the hire of academic dress should be made directly with Phelan Conan by phoning 01-4295300. The student helpline is 1800 808 818 / studenthelpline@phelanconan.com

On the day of your conferring it is recommended that you bring safety pins and hair clips with you to secure your cap and hood.
